Transaction 66ccc72ee890329c47e6cfa4e5875deb408b3e2636e5e64fde0236ff052be779

1 Input
2 Outputs
  • 66ccc72ee890329c47e6cfa4e5875deb408b3e2636e5e64fde0236ff052be779:0
  • value  198187408
    address  3D7j1vEwZwpfjmg5VvoLmQrTLuYpXTGgm5
  • 66ccc72ee890329c47e6cfa4e5875deb408b3e2636e5e64fde0236ff052be779:1
  • value  13444400
    address  3ByHVr9JnFnCP9TL7KL3z7XvGw3EPTpUWb